i pulled this out of a different thread that was about dropping a h22a into a civic. but my car is an integra(non vtec) one person's opinion was to turbo my original motor after doing the internals. while this would definately add more power than putting a h22a in my car, this is my argument for the big motor (relatively speaking) :

adding turbo lag to a tourque-less 1.8 liter is not my idea of the best daily driver. during my commute i spend about as much time below 4000 rpm as above it. a 2.2 liter sounds ALOT more like the speedy daily driver i have in mind.

besides, this way of developing the car has much more potential. if i were to supercharge the h22a at a later time, the car would get pretty sick at the track, and would have even more daily-torque in the low end. what do you think everyone?

i'm pretty convinced it sounds like a good idea, but does anyone know anyone who knows anyone who has done this?
